About Richemont
Richemont is one of the world’s foremost luxury groups, stewarding a distinguished portfolio of maisons across jewellery, watchmaking, fashion and accessories, including Cartier, Van Cleef & Arpels, Jaeger-LeCoultre and Montblanc. As an employer, it combines the heritage of artisanal excellence with a forward-looking culture shaped by innovation, client-centricity and responsible business. Its global teams operate in an environment that values craftsmanship, entrepreneurship and collaboration, offering opportunities to grow within iconic maisons and group functions alike. Richemont attracts professionals who aspire to contribute to enduring luxury, preserving rare savoir-faire while helping define the future of high craftsmanship.

Role & Responsibilities
- Develop and execute merchandising strategies aligned with luxury timepiece market positioning across HKMO region
- Collaborate with retail, marketing, and supply chain teams to optimize product assortment and inventory levels
- Analyze sales performance and market trends to inform product placement and promotional strategies
- Support brand equity maintenance through adherence to visual merchandising and product presentation standards
- Monitor competitor activities and consumer preferences to identify merchandising opportunities
Qualifications
- Advanced proficiency in English and Cantonese or Mandarin
- Strong understanding of luxury watches market dynamics
- Experience with merchandising systems and retail planning tools
- Demonstrated ability to work effectively in matrix organizational structures
